The BADC quadrilateral
AB= AD
BC= DC
This quadrilateral's symmetry line is AC.
Think about the triangles BAC and DAC.
These triangles contain
AB = AD
BC = DC
AC = AC - reflexive property
So, the SSS postulate of ΔBAC ≅ ΔDAC
Congruent triangles have comparable sides and angles that are also congruent, so ∠ACB = ∠ACD
Another concept: The line that separates the figure into two identical figures is the line of symmetry. As a result, ΔBAC and ΔDAC share the same properties (are congruent) and have the same corresponding sides and angles.

We have been given that Amelia bought a pair of pants for $25. She also bought two shirts that were originally $12 each, but were on sale for buy one and get the second for half price.
The price of 2nd short would half o $12 that is .
The total cost of clothes before tax would be cost of pair of pants plus two shirts.
Amelia paid a 6% sales tax on the total cost of the clothes, so total cost of clothes would be $43 plus 6% of $43.
Therefore, the final cost of clothes after tax was $45.58.
